Understanding Pain Relief Medications: A Comprehensive Guide
Pain is a universal experience, yet it can vary exceptionally in its nature, intensity, and duration. Persistent pain can significantly affect one's quality of life, making pain relief medications an important aspect of health care. This post intends to offer an in-depth introduction of pain relief medications, classifying them, noting their typical uses, and dealing with often asked concerns.
Kinds Of Pain Relief Medications
Pain relief medications can be broadly classified into two classifications: analgesics and adjuvant medications. Below is a table summing up these classifications, including their subclasses and examples of each.

Non-opioid analgesics are normally the very first line of defense for pain management due to their schedule and lower danger profile.

Acetaminophen: Effective for moderate to moderate pain, it is often recommended for Schmerzmittel Kaufen headaches, muscle pains, and fever. Overuse can cause liver damage.

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s): These consist of ibuprofen and naproxen, which work for reducing both pain and inflammation. They are extensively used for conditions such as arthritis and sports injuries.
Opioid Analgesics
Opioids are strong pain relievers normally prescribed for moderate to extreme pain, such as post-surgical pain or pharmaceutical Shop cancer pain. While they can be highly efficient, they likewise carry a risk of addiction and negative effects.

Morphine: Frequently utilized for Apotheke extreme pain control in medical facility settings, particularly post-surgery.

Oxycodone and Hydrocodone: Often recommended for chronic pain management, these medications can be habit-forming.

Fentanyl: Available in spot type for chronic pain management, it is one of the most powerful opioids and is typically reserved for extreme pain.
Adjuvant Medications
Adjuvant medications are not mostly developed for pain relief however can be reliable for particular types of pain, especially neuropathic pain.

Antidepressants: Certain antidepressants like amitriptyline can help ease neuropathic pain due to their capability to modify pain transmission pathways.

Anticonvulsants: Medications such as gabapentin are commonly utilized for nerve pain conditions like diabetic neuropathy and postherpetic neuralgia.

Muscle Relaxants: Medications such as cyclobenzaprine can assist in lowering muscle spasms, which might trigger or worsen pain.
How to Choose the Right Pain Relief Medication
Choosing the suitable pain relief medication can be challenging due to different aspects, including the reason for pain, client history, and potential side results. Here are some vital considerations:

Identify the Type of Pain: Understanding whether the pain is acute, chronic, nociceptive, or neuropathic is vital in choosing the ideal treatment.

Consult a Healthcare Professional: A physician can offer guidance based on a person's case history and specific requirements.

Consider Potential Side Effects: All medications carry risks. Opioids might trigger sedation and constipation, while NSAIDs can lead to intestinal issues.

Follow Recommended Dosages: It's crucial to follow recommended dosages to reduce dangers and optimize efficacy.
